site stats

React slots typescript

WebThe slots prop is an object that lets you override any interior subcomponents—known as slots —of the base component itself. Each component contains a root slot, and other appropriate slots based on the nature of the component. For example, the Unstyled Badge contains two slots: root: the container element that wraps the children. WebAdding TypeScript to existing ReactJS application You already have a running React app, and wanted to add TypeScript to it, Must of the cases, there is a high possibility of your app breaking ...

Patreon is hiring Staff Frontend Engineer, Growth - Reddit

WebNov 9, 2024 · Для создания интерфейсов React рекомендует использовать композицию и библиотеки по управлению состоянием (state management libraries) для построения иерархий компонентов. Однако при сложных паттернах... Webtypescript标志在创建React Appv4.0.0后已被弃用 我们在创建新应用程序时删除了不推荐使用的typescript标志。使用--template typescript。我们还删除了不推荐使用的NODE_PATH标志,因为它已被替换为在中设置基路径jsconfig.json文件. Official Changelog can i substitute almond butter for tahini https://staticdarkness.com

Forms and Events React TypeScript Cheatsheets

WebJul 24, 2024 · Vue Slots in React In React, we pass elements to a component by simply passing elements to a prop. Here’s an example: It works! But what if we could improve our … WebFeb 2, 2024 · React developer team has removed create-react-app (CRA) from official documentation rendering it no longer the default setup method for new projects. The … WebThe element is a placeholder for external HTML content, allowing you to inject (or “slot”) child elements from other files into your component template.. By default, all child elements passed to a component will be rendered in its . Note Unlike props, which are attributes passed to an Astro component available for use throughout your … fivem free scripts

Using TypeScript with React DigitalOcean

Category:React children composition patterns with TypeScript - Medium

Tags:React slots typescript

React slots typescript

What interface should props extends to have "slot" …

WebJul 10, 2024 · In this article we will examine all possible/useful React children composition patterns backed up by TypeScript 💪. 1. props.children (default slot projection) Let’s build a … WebPassing slots as functions allows them to be invoked lazily by the child component. This leads to the slot's dependencies being tracked by the child instead of the parent, which results in more accurate and efficient updates. Built-in Components

React slots typescript

Did you know?

WebReact TypeScript supports JSX and can correctly model the patterns used in React codebases like useState. Getting Set Up With a React Project Today there are many frameworks which support TypeScript out of the box: Create React App - TS docs Next.js - TS docs Gatsby - TS Docs All of these are great starting points. WebWith TypeScript When using TypeScript, you must first create a new type for your pages which includes a getLayout function. Then, you must create a new type for your AppProps which overrides the Component property to use the previously created type.

WebJun 25, 2024 · In this section, you will learn how to use slots to manage children in Lit. Slots & Children. Code Checkpoint (TS) Slots enable composition by allowing you to nest components. In React, children are inherited through props. The default slot is props.children and the render function defines where the default slot is positioned. For … WebTypeScript ships with three JSX modes: preserve, react, and react-native . These modes only affect the emit stage - type checking is unaffected. The preserve mode will keep the JSX as part of the output to be further consumed by another transform step (e.g. Babel ). Additionally the output will have a .jsx file extension.

WebNov 1, 2024 · Primer React, the React implementation of GitHub's Primer Design System, uses slots based on the React Context API which solves this problem. A Slots component … WebPatreon is hiring Staff Frontend Engineer, Growth USD 189k-263k [San Francisco, CA] [TypeScript gRPC Next.js React JavaScript Flask Node.js API Android] echojobs.io. comments sorted by Best Top New Controversial Q&A Add a Comment ... Game Of Thrones Slots (Backend) USD 85k-190k [San Francisco, CA] [Redis C# AWS Go PHP C++ Python …

WebTypeScript. Astro ships with built-in support for TypeScript. You can import .ts and .tsx files in your Astro project, write TypeScript code directly inside your Astro component, and even use an astro.config.ts file if you like. Using TypeScript, you can prevent errors at runtime by defining the shapes of objects and components in your code.

WebIn Typescript React Component, Function takes props object and returns JSX data. Let’s create a props object of the type MessageProps interface MessageProps { message: string; } Also, Can use type in place of the interface type MessageProps { message: string; } Let’s see multiple ways to create Typescript functional components can i substitute butter shortening for butterWebApr 19, 2024 · In the terminal, navigate to your app directory, where you’ll want to install TypeScript: npm install --save typescript @types /node @types /react @types /react- dom … can i substitute cornstarch for potato starchfivem freeroam serversWebReact Developer ( Only those people can apply who can come to Noida Onsite )( with 1 month or Immediate Notice only ) Work Location : Noida, Uttar Pradesh. Work Experience : 1-3 years (Freshers Do Not Apply) Must Have Skills. Hands on understanding of developing SPA (Single Page Application) using React JS -JavaScript library and associated ... five m free hacksWebFeb 11, 2024 · First, install the React dependencies react and react-dom: Then create the index.html file to insert into the src folder. You can do this with your preferred text editor. … fivem free spooferWebIt's quite common to need to create types for props (and state) when using React and TypeScript together. You apparently already have a type that's defined as: type … fivem freeze entityWebApr 24, 2024 · If you are creating a new React app using create-react-app v2.1 or higher, Typescript is already built in. So, to set up a new project with Typescript, simply use --typescript as a parameter. npx create-react-app hello-tsx --typescript. This creates a project called my-app, but you can change the name. can i substitute coconut milk for heavy cream